Rohri/ Sukkur vs Atlanta, Georgia Climate & Distance Between

Usa flag
  • The distance between Rohri/ Sukkur, Pakistan and Atlanta, Georgia, Usa is approximately 12,639 km or 7,854 mi.
  • To reach Rohri/ Sukkur in this distance one would set out from Atlanta, Georgia bearing 25.7°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Rohri/ Sukkur bearing 155.9° or SSE .
  • Rohri/ Sukkur has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h) whereas Atlanta, Georgia has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
  • Rohri/ Sukkur is in or near the subtropical desert biome whereas Atlanta, Georgia is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ome.
  • The mean annual temperature is 10.6 °C (19.1°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 0.6 °C (1.1°F) less in Rohri/ Sukkur. The continentality subtype is semicontinental as opposed to subcontinental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 1201.5 mm (47.3 in) less which is equivalent to 1201.5 l/m² (29.49 US gal/ft²) or 12,015,000 l/ha (1,284,483 US gal/ac) less. About 0 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 6° higher in Rohri/ Sukkur than in Atlanta, Georgia.
